Visitation Center of New York is a pregnancy care center located in New York, New York. Situated at 7 State Street, this center provides essential support and resources for individuals facing pregnancy-related challenges. The facility is designed to offer a compassionate environment where clients can access information, counseling, and assistance tailored to their unique needs. As a local organization, the center plays a significant role in the community by addressing the concerns of expectant mothers and their families.
The center offers a range of services focused on pregnancy care, including guidance on prenatal health, parenting education, and emotional support.
